Welcome to Townsite Campground, a hidden gem located in the stunning landscape of Improvement District No. 4, Alberta. Nestled between majestic mountains, this campground offers a unique and serene camping experience for nature lovers, families, and RV enthusiasts alike.

Our campground features spacious campsites that provide ample room for your RV, trailer, or tent, ensuring a comfortable stay. The well-maintained grounds are surrounded by breathtaking scenery, making it an ideal spot for relaxation and adventure. One of the highlights of Townsite Campground is its beautiful rock beach, where you can unwind and soak in the natural beauty.

For those who love outdoor activities, the campground is conveniently located near several hiking trails, offering opportunities to explore the surrounding wilderness. Whether you're an experienced hiker or just looking for a leisurely walk, there's something for everyone.

Families will appreciate the safe and welcoming environment of Townsite Campground. Many visitors have shared their positive experiences, noting how comfortable they felt letting their children explore the area independently. The charming village nearby adds to the overall appeal, making it a perfect destination for a family getaway.

Great place to camp! Showers were warm, deer visited us regularly. The Canada Website was annoying and took way to long to book a site, but great once you're here. *Note no campfires, but propane rings allowed

Location of this campground is amazing! Near Waterton lake and sorrounded by mountains. Sunsets and sunrises are just fantastic. The washrooms and showers were very clean but the showers had just one setting for water temperature and that was lava hot! The other problem is lots of gopher holes if you are in the tent section of the campground.
